Hello, my name is Jawad. I am a 1st year student at Yozgat Bozok University, Department of Computer Engineering. In 2021, I came to Yozgat from Morocco.
Normally, I wanted to study computer engineering in my own country. However, it is a bit difficult to choose this department in my country. So I looked at other countries and chose Yozgat Bozok University in Turkey.
The thing I thought about the most before coming to Turkey was the language. I was thinking about how I could find friends because I was going to come to a foreign country, so I was a bit scared. Now, of course, I am better. Especially the university helped me a lot. I made a lot of friends in the first two months and I improved my Turkish more.
I searched for universities in Turkey on the internet and saw Yozgat Bozok University in the advertisements. I applied from the university's website and my registration process was very easy, the professors were very helpful.
After I came to Yozgat Bozok University, I improved my Turkish and was able to communicate better with my friends.
I did not have any big problems, but there were small problems. My professors and university staff were very helpful when I had a problem.
While studying computer engineering, we get more hands-on training. This makes it more memorable. That is why I am satisfied with the education I received.
Since I live alone, I learned how to cook, how to solve my problems on my own and especially how to communicate with my Turkish friends, and I also learned how to work disciplined.
In the first months of my arrival, Yozgat Bozok University organized activities for us. We went to other embassies and tasted different foods. For example, I ate kebabs, barbecue, pancakes, etc. We also went to museums and learned about Ottoman history. These activities were very useful for us.

My advice to new students coming to our university; make friends, if you have any problems, our professors always help you. You can also participate in activities and explore Yozgat.
After graduation, I want to study for a master's degree and live in Turkey. I wish success to the students who will take the university exam. We welcome everyone to Yozgat Bozok University.
